A.On an applicant's receipt of the net proceeds of the issuance of the transition bonds under section 40-606, subsection A, the commission has the authority to ensure that:
1.Any undepreciated value of the transition assets on the applicant's books are reduced by the corresponding amount, including any reductions in associated regulatory assets or recorded liabilities, as applicable.
2.Any regulatory assets that are related to significant event recovery costs are reduced by that corresponding amount.
3.Any incurred costs of a recorded liability that are incurred and associated with significant event recovery costs are reduced by that corresponding amount.
